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ight

When I first created the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ight, I knew I wanted something quick yet nourishing. The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ight is my go-to weeknight meal when time is tight but I still crave something wholesome and satisfying. This dish brings together crispy, marinated tofu and vibrant, fresh vegetables, all tossed in a savory stir-fry. It’s the perfect blend of flavors and textures, making it a favorite among my friends and family.

Cooking the Perfect Stir Fry

I remember the first time I made this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ight. The kitchen was filled with the wonderful aroma of garlic and ginger sizzling away. As I tossed the tofu in curry powder and tamari, the cubes turned golden brown and crispy. The kale and red cabbage, quickly stir-fried to just the right tenderness, added a burst of color and crunch. The whole wheat noodles, cooked perfectly, acted as the ideal base for this delicious stir-fry.

A Feast for the Eyes

The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ight is not just a treat for the taste buds but also a feast for the eyes. The contrast of the dark, leafy kale against the bright red cabbage and the golden tofu makes for a visually appealing dish. Each bite offers a satisfying crunch and a blend of spices that dance on the palate. Whether I’m cooking for myself or a crowd, this dish never fails to impress with its simplicity and flavor.

Versatility and Comfort

What I love most about the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ight is how versatile it is. You can easily swap out the tofu for tempeh or seitan, and switch up the vegetables based on what’s in season. It’s a quick and healthy option that fits perfectly into a busy lifestyle, providing both comfort and nourishment. Every time I make it, I’m reminded of how a few fresh ingredients can come together to create something truly delightful.

Chef’s Notes-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ight

  • Drain and Press Tofu: For best results, drain and press the tofu for at least 15 minutes before marinating. This will remove excess moisture and allow the tofu to absorb more flavor.
  • Even Cooking: Cut the tofu into even-sized cubes to ensure they cook evenly and get crispy on all sides.
  • High Heat for Stir-Fry: Use high heat when stir-frying the vegetables to retain their vibrant color and crisp texture.
  • Quick Cooking: Stir-fry the vegetables quickly to avoid overcooking and to keep them slightly crunchy.
  • Batch Cooking Tofu: If the tofu doesn’t fit in the pan in a single layer, cook it in batches to ensure it crisps up nicely.
  • Noodle Alternatives: For a lighter option, try using zucchini noodles or a mix of zucchini and whole wheat noodles.
  • Ginger and Garlic: Be careful not to burn the garlic and ginger. Add them to the pan just before adding the other vegetables to prevent overcooking.
  • Customize to Taste: Adjust the amount of soy sauce or tamari to your taste preference. You can also add a pinch of chili flakes if you like a bit of heat.
  • Presentation: Garnish the finished dish with a sprinkle of sesame seeds, chopped green onions, or a drizzle of sesame oil for added flavor and presentation.

Ingredients

  • Crispy Tofu
  • 1 block firm tofu 7 ounces

  • 1 1/2 teaspoons curry powder

  • 1 tablespoon tamari or soy sauce

  • Stir Fry
  • 1/4 head red cabbage thinly sliced

  • 3-4 large kale leaves stems removed and chopped

  • 1 large carrot julienned or spiralized

  • 1 clove garlic minced

  • 1-inch piece fresh ginger minced

  • 2 tablespoons tamari or soy sauce

  • 2 portions whole wheat noodles

  • Alternative Ingredients
  • Tofu

  • Tempeh or seitan for a different texture.

  • Soy Sauce

  • Coconut aminos for a soy-free option.

  • Whole Wheat Noodles

  • Rice noodles or zucchini noodles for gluten-free.

Directions

  • Marinate Tofu: Cut the tofu into 1-inch cubes. Combine curry powder and tamari to form a paste. Toss tofu cubes in the paste until well-coated. Set aside.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ight_ post 1
  • Cook Noodles: Prepare noodles according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ight_ post 2
  • Prep Vegetables: Julienne or spiralize the carrot. Mince the garlic and ginger. Thinly slice the red cabbage and chop the kale leaves.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ight_ post 3
  • Cook Tofu: Heat a nonstick pan over high heat with a little oil. Add tofu cubes and cook until golden brown on all sides, turning frequently (about 8-10 minutes).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ight_ post 4
  • Combine Ingredients: In another nonstick pan over high heat with a little oil, add garlic and ginger. Cook for 1 minute until fragrant. Add kale and cabbage; stir-fry for 2-3 minutes until they begin to wilt. Add julienned carrot and tamari to the vegetable mix. Stir-fry for another 2 minutes.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ight_ post 5
  • Serve: Place cooked noodles on plates, top with stir-fried vegetables and crispy tofu. Serve immediately.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ight_ post 6

FAQs-Tofu & Kale Stir Fry Delight

Can I make this dish gluten-free?

Yes, you can substitute the whole wheat noodles with rice noodles or zucchini noodles, and use tamari or coconut aminos instead of soy sauce.

How can I make the tofu extra crispy?

Press the tofu to remove excess moisture, and cook it in batches in a hot pan with a little oil. Make sure not to overcrowd the pan to allow the tofu to crisp up.

Can I use other vegetables in this stir fry?

Absolutely! Feel free to add bell peppers, snap peas, broccoli, or any other vegetables you enjoy.

How long can I store leftovers?

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at gently in a pan over medium heat or in the microwave.

What can I serve with this stir fry?

This stir fry pairs well with steamed rice, quinoa, or a side of miso soup. You can also add a light salad for a complete meal.
